Title 16 › Chapter CHAPTER 1— - NATIONAL PARKS, MILITARY PARKS, MONUMENTS, AND SEASHORES › Subchapter SUBCHAPTER LXXXIII— - KING RANGE NATIONAL CONSERVATION AREA › § 460y–3
The Secretary may establish the Area only after 90 calendar days have passed since he sent the required program to Congress leaders, the Governor of California, and the county governing body, and after he published notice in the Federal Register and in at least two newspapers.
